Position Description

We are seeking a highly skilled and experienced Senior Structural Engineer - Mining & Industrial to join our team for our Canadian mine infrastructure team.

The successful candidate will leverage their expertise in civil/structural engineering to deliver practical solutions that enhance the performance, reliability, and safety of our clients' mining-related infrastructure. This role serves as a centralized inspection and asset integrity specialist. You will act as the tip of the spear for remote field execution, undertaking visual structural condition assessments at active underground/open pit mines, process plants, and critical water/wastewater facilities (such as water retaining walls, treatment plants, and reservoirs).

Additionally, the candidate will work closely with clients, mentor junior staff, and support strategic initiatives to expand our market presence in the mining sector.

Key Responsibilities

Asset Management & Field Inspections:
  • Execute hands-on visual structural condition assessments across a diverse portfolio, including remote mining environments, and critical water infrastructure (e.g., retaining walls, clarifiers, pump stations, and reservoirs).
  • Assess elevated walkways, ladders, and platforms against specific client and regulatory standards.
  • Verify load paths, corrosion, concrete degradation, deformation, weld conditions, and anchorage integrity during site inspections.
  • Analyze field findings to assign severity classifications in alignment with structural priority systems.
  • Create comprehensive field inspection reports using approved templates and capture precise deficiency data via annotated redline drawings and high-resolution photos.
  • Immediately escalate any imminent risk conditions to the client and internal project managers.

Engineering Response & Remediation:
  • Prepare detailed structural response actions, repair plans, and engineering assessments based on inspection findings for both heavy industrial and water-retaining structures.
  • Provide engineering solutions to extend the lifespan of existing facilities, including troubleshooting structural deterioration and implementing ground-improvement coordination.
  • Write clear, comprehensive construction specifications for structural remediation and brownfield integration.

Qualifications

Minimum Requirements:
  • Bachelor's degree in civil or structural engineering (or equivalent).
  • 6+ years of structural engineering experience, with a heavy emphasis on asset management, structural condition assessments, and brownfield remediation.
  • Demonstrated physical ability and willingness to perform hands-on field inspections in challenging environments, ranging from remote underground mines to active water treatment facilities.
  • Expert-level knowledge of Canadian structural design codes (CSA S16 for structural steel and CSA A23.3 for concrete).
  • Access to a vehicle, a valid driver's license, and a clean driver's record are required for this position.

Preferred Skills:
  • 10+ years of dedicated structural inspection and remediation experience.
  • Registered as a Professional Engineer (P.Eng.) in British Columbia, Alberta, or Saskatchewan (or eligible for registration within 6 months).
  • Specific expertise in assessing and designing water-retaining structures in accordance with relevant codes (e.g., ACI 350 or equivalent standards).
  • Proficiency in structural design and analysis software such as STAAD Pro, SAP2000, or ETABS.
  • Familiarity with drafting and modeling software such as AutoCAD, Revit, and Navisworks.
  • Familiarity with non-destructive testing (NDT) oversight and specifying advanced concrete/steel testing protocols.

About AECOM

AECOM is a global provider of professional technical and management support services to a broad range of markets, including transportation, facilities, environmental, energy, water and government. With approximately 45,000 employees around the world, AECOM is a leader in all of the key markets that it serves. AECOM provides a blend of global reach, local knowledge, innovation and technical excellence in delivering solutions that create, enhance and sustain the world's built, natural, and social environments. A Fortune 500 company, AECOM serves clients in more than 150 countries and had revenue of $8.0 billion during the 12 months ended March 31, 2014.
